In VBA, per verificare se una directory esiste, si utilizza tipicamente la funzione Dir combinata con l’attributo vbDirectory.
Dir
vbDirectory
In VBA, la creazione di un file temporaneo può essere realizzata utilizzando il FileSystemObject disponibile nella libreria Microsoft Scripting Runtime.
FileSystemObject
Il modo più semplice per leggere un file di testo in VBA è utilizzare l’istruzione Open in combinazione con le funzioni Input o Line Input.
Open
Input
Line Input
A differenza di ambienti di programmazione più diretti, VBA non ha una funzionalità integrata per leggere direttamente gli argomenti della riga di comando in senso convenzionale perché è principalmente progettato per essere incorporato all’interno delle applicazioni Microsoft Office.
VBA offre diversi metodi per scrivere in un file, ma uno dei modi più semplici è utilizzare FileSystemObject.
In VBA, non essendoci una funzione incorporata diretta per scrivere specificamente sull’errore standard come in alcuni altri linguaggi di programmazione, un’alternativa comune consiste nell’utilizzare Debug.Print per l’output degli errori durante lo sviluppo o creare una funzione di logging personalizzata che imita questo comportamento per le applicazioni in produzione.
Debug.Print